- the present invention relates to a masking device and a method of masking.
- Aircraft skins have many fasteners such as nuts or rivets over the surface. These require to be painted in order to protect them from the harsh environment that they exist in. The way that the fasteners are painted is by hand. Frequently not all of the fastener is covered and more frequently more area than the fastener is covered. This gives rise to an ugly appearance of the painted fastener. Furthermore, painting each fastener is extremely time consuming.

- a masking device 10 includes a handle 12 and a masking region 14.
- the masking region 14 includes a base 16 and an opening 18 which opening 18 may be a complete enclosure.
- the opening 18 diverges upwardly and outwardly away from the base to form a countersunk portion 20.
- the handle 12 extends upwardly and outwardly to one side of the base 16.
- the operative with one hand, will bring the opening 18 over a fastener feeling such as a nut or rivet 22 with the base 16 resting on, for instance, an aircraft skin 24.
- the operative will then apply a coat such as by painting the fastener such as, for example, by using a sponge, pad or spray applicator to cover the top and sides of the fastener 22.
- a coat such as by painting the fastener such as, for example, by using a sponge, pad or spray applicator to cover the top and sides of the fastener 22.
- the masking could be applied to an outwardly or a downwardly facing surface to be coated.
- the opening 18 may be substantially the same diameter as the fastener 22 or may be larger. When the opening 18 is larger than the diameter of the fastener 22, paint from the applicator may not only cover the exposed portion of the fastener 22 but may also cover a small region of the skin surrounding the fastener 22.
- the height from the base 16 to a top surface 30 may vary as may the area of the openings 18 or 18a.
- Figure 3 shows an opening 18a that is hexagonal in shape in order to enable fasteners having that shape to be coated or painted.
- Other features of Figure 3 can be those referred to above in relation to Figures 1 and 2 .
- Figures 4, 5 and 6 are modifications that can be made to the masking region.
- the base 16 in Figure 1 is shown as being flat and resting over its complete surface against the aircraft skin 24. It is possible that paint may leak outwardly between the skin and the base 16 such that, when several rivets are coated in succession the skin 24 will have paint inadvertently applied to regions where paint is not desired. Consequently, in Figure 5 the opening 18 includes a downwardly extending rim or spacer 28 such that the flat base 16 will be held clear of the aircraft skin.
- the spacer may be a continous rim or may comprise discrete spacers adjacent to the opening.
- Coating may also accumulate on the top surface 30 of the masking region. This coating may flow over the masking region and onto the skin again applying a coating where this is not required.
- an upwardly extending peripheral rim 32 may be provided.
- the problem may be still further alleviated by the rim 32 including a peripheral rib 34 extending inwardly from the upper portion of the rim 32 with the rib 34 being spaced from the top surface 30.
- the masking device can be made out of any suitable material.
- the masking device could be of plastics material and my be integrally moulded out of high density polyethylene which may be coated with fluorinate in order to assist cleansing.
- parts of the masking region may be broken off if those parts would otherwise abut a protrusion on the aircraft skin that otherwise would not permit the location of the opening over the fastener.
- weakening lines may be provided in the masking region to assist in the accurate breaking off of the desired part.
- the masking region or the handle or both parts may comprise a metal portion.
- the handle 12 may be detachably connected to the masking region such as, for instance, by incorporating a screw thread and threaded recess or by a push-fit of a protrusion into a tight recess.
- Figure 7 shows a masking region 14 formed with a series of concentric weakened or perforated lines 14A.
- the inner part from any concentric line can be detached such as by punching the inner part out to give an opening 18 of the derived diameter.
- the present invention is not limited to the opening being circular and any shaped opening is envisaged.
- Figures 7 and 8 may be made of plastic at least in the region of the masking region 14.
- Figures 9 and 10 show an alternative embodiment in which the diameter of the opening 18 can be reduced by adding one or more discs 36.
- Disks may be arranged to engage with the internal diameter or formation of the region 14 such as by being a friction fit or by cooperating threads.
- the discs may have a different internal diameter.
- the discs 36 may be metal. They may be disposable or alternatively or additionally, may be able to be removed and reattached. For example they may be removed for cleaning.
- Figure 11 is a plan view of a masking device in which the opening 18 is not a complete enclosure. Instead the opening 18 has spaced ends 38. The spaced ends may effect an opening of that is enclose b less than half by half or more than half, as shown. In the example shown more than 180° is enclosed such as 200°. figure 11 may have any of the modifications previously described including the modifications shown in Figures 7 and 8 or 9 and 10.
